National Eating Disorder Month
February is the month dedicated to increasing public awareness of eating disorders. Therefore, I am doing my best to increase awarenewess and knowledge. One way that I am doing this is by creating an "event" on facebook called "National Eating Disorder Month Invitational." It is my hope to bring together people's stories of recovery, hope and strength. I want to inspire others to attain abstinence. Eating disorders are a matter of life or death. We definitely need to work together as a society to protect future generations through education and prevention. This is an area that I am extremely passionate about. After nearly 30 years of my own battles, I cannot begin to describe the peace I have found in being abstinent. I am grateful to all of those who have and continue to provide support, love, and understanding. Together, we can conquer our demons.
